Job Description
The IT Program Manager will advise on, oversee, and manage the technical direction of several Pharmacy Benefit Manager migrations across the Company’s health plan clients. These projects/programs will be carried out in conjunction with project team members and stakeholders, ensuring that the processes are integrated, coordinated, timed, and consistent throughout. The IT Program Manager is in charge of identifying and analyzing existing state PBM infrastructure, as well as making recommendations for future state based on client needs, PBM capabilities, and industry best practices. As a result, this position must have a working knowledge of the technical components required for a successful PBM implementation, such as eligibility, accumulators, benefits, digital/web portals, reporting, and claims.
